To design my card I started with my designer paper choice. I don't have much that would be considered 'vintage' but I do have the Classic Garage designer series paper which have vintage patterns and colors: Basic Black, Basic Gray, Crushed Curry, Pumpkin Pie, Read Red, Tranquil Tide, Very Vanilla and Whisper White.
I decided right away that I would choose a pattern that had Tranquil Tide as I wanted that to be one of my layer colors. I found the pattern that I liked and cut it as a layer as well, 1/4" smaller than Tranquil Tide.
Then, something new, which just happens to be a die-cut too! I just got the Well Written framelits and chose to use 'happy' as the phrase on the front of my card:
Simple but oh so cute and I love the way the sequins shine in the light. I added a Basic Black Solid Baker's Twine knot up the left side and my card was done.
